New Research Alliance for the Preservation of Cultural Heritage

 



Their aim is to significantly improve the conditions for the protection of cultural artefacts, to strengthen the development of new scholarly talent and to broaden the various national and international networks of parties involved. Leading on from the leading role played by conservation sciences in Germany before the Second World War, the task now is to lay the foundations for the consolidation and expansion of this branch of research for the future. Taking stock of the status quo at a national level is the first step in being able to establish precisely which measures need to be taken. In order to achieve a strengthening of the discipline, an awareness of its significance has to be instilled at both the public and political level.

With the formation of this alliance, a leap has been made into uncharted territory. For the first time ever one of the world's largest collections of cultural artefacts and its team of expert staff and advisors (the Foundation of Prussian Cultural Heritage), together with one of the leading user-orientated technological research institutions in Germany (the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ft) and a unique cross-level scientific organization (the Leibniz-Gemeinschaft) will be combining their efforts to reach their common goal.
The new joint project will lead to innovative restoration and conservation techniques being developed, with cultural heritage being better protected as a result.
